#include "qmf/PrivateImplRef.h"
#include "qmf/exceptions.h"
#include "qmf/SubscriptionImpl.h"
#include "qmf/DataImpl.h"
using namespace std;
using namespace qmf;
using qpid::types::Variant;
typedef PrivateImplRef<Subscription> PI;
Subscription::Subscription(SubscriptionImpl* impl) { PI::ctor(*this, impl); }
Subscription::Subscription(const Subscription& s) : qmf::Handle<SubscriptionImpl>() { PI::copy(*this, s); }
Subscription::~Subscription() { PI::dtor(*this); }
Subscription& Subscription::operator=(const Subscription& s) { return PI::assign(*this, s); }
void Subscription::cancel() { impl->cancel(); }
bool Subscription::isActive() const { return impl->isActive(); }
void Subscription::lock() { impl->lock(); }
void Subscription::unlock() { impl->unlock(); }
uint32_t Subscription::getDataCount() const { return impl->getDataCount(); }
Data Subscription::getData(uint32_t i) const { return impl->getData(i); }
void SubscriptionImpl::cancel()
{
}
bool SubscriptionImpl::isActive() const
{
return false;
}
void SubscriptionImpl::lock()
{
}
void SubscriptionImpl::unlock()
{
}
uint32_t SubscriptionImpl::getDataCount() const
{
return 0;
}
Data SubscriptionImpl::getData(uint32_t) const
{
return Data();
}
SubscriptionImpl& SubscriptionImplAccess::get(Subscription& item)
{
return *item.impl;
}
const SubscriptionImpl& SubscriptionImplAccess::get(const Subscription& item)
{
return *item.impl;
}
